INFSCI 1028 - GOING DIGITAL: TRANSFORMATIONAL CHANGE


Minimum Credits: 3
Maximum Credits: 3
New digital tools are disrupting traditional business models, forcing organizations to develop new business models and strategies that not only strengthen capabilities and drive growth, but also provide a significant competitive advantage. IT business analysts and consultants are uniquely positioned to help organizations integrate these initiatives to solve their most pressing business problems. This course is designed to build IT consulting skills that enhance critical thinking, problem solving, written and oral communication, and presentation capabilities. The course is taught through a combination of lecture, class discussions, case studies and team based projects.
